你查询的IP:[122.51.215.244]  地理位置:中国–上海–上海

最新查询119.62.55.230 117.121.95.49 221.34.100.134 221.192.164.58 122.8.18.139 122.204.194.147 221.224.203.190 59.108.141.47 222.240.114.158 122.51.215.244 120.80.119.226 222.240.249.68 202.124.24.44 202.38.160.204 116.52.85.149 60.247.18.232 202.136.224.79 118.224.77.33 202.148.96.95 203.100.192.212 221.12.27.71 134.196.74.82 117.59.247.240 122.224.240.105 222.64.16.221 125.64.66.53 218.249.148.158 202.14.88.159 221.224.16.180 203.191.64.216 58.66.102.165